In 2026, IT internships have become one of the most important steps for students who want to build a successful career in technology. With the rapid growth of digital industries, companies are actively hiring interns to train and develop future professionals.

In today’s competitive IT industry, students need more than just academic knowledge to build a successful career. Practical skills, industry exposure, and real-world experience have become very important. That is why many students choose internships or training programs during their studies.

However, a common question among IT students is: “Which is better – Internship or Training?”

The answer depends on your learning stage, career goals, and skill level. Both internships and training programs offer unique benefits that help students grow professionally.

What is IT Training?

IT training is a learning program designed to teach technical skills, software tools, programming languages, and industry concepts. Training programs are usually conducted by institutes, online platforms, or companies.

Students learn through:

  • Lectures and guidance
  • Practical exercises
  • Assignments and mini projects
  • Technology-based learning modules

Training focuses mainly on improving technical knowledge and building foundational skills.

What is an Internship?

An internship is a professional work experience program where students work with a company or organization for a limited time. Internships allow students to apply their skills in real-world projects and understand actual work environments.

Interns usually:

  • Work on live projects
  • Collaborate with teams
  • Follow company workflows
  • Solve real business problems

Internships focus more on practical industry exposure than theoretical learning.
